The repairs behind every symptom
A door is a simple machine wearing out in a predictable order. A door that slams or feels heavy is a spring problem. One that ties itself in knots going up is a cable or track problem. Grinding is rollers; a door that reverses for no reason is sensors or heat-stiffened lubricant. Why Arizona kills doors faster
Garage temperatures here pass 130°F in summer, which ages steel springs, dries lubricant into paste and cooks weather seals brittle. Monsoon dust grinds in rollers and blinds safety sensors. The practical answer is repair done with heat-rated lubricant and honest parts — and a yearly tune-up that catches wear while it's still cheap.

Can I use the door before you arrive?
If a spring or cable is broken, please don't — the counterbalance is gone and the full door weight is loose in the system. Leave it closed and keep people and cars clear.
